What is The Doctor's Kitchen?
The Doctor's Kitchen is a brand founded by Dr. Rupy Aujla that aims to inspire people to eat more healthily and live happier lives. Dr. Aujla believes that food is medicine and that by making simple changes to our diet, we can prevent and even reverse chronic diseases.
Through his books, podcasts, and TV series, Dr. Aujla shares evidence-based information about nutrition and health, as well as easy and delicious recipes that anyone can make at home. His recipes are always based on whole, unprocessed foods, and are free from additives, preservatives, and refined sugars.
What is Cooking In The Doctor's Kitchen?
Cooking In The Doctor's Kitchen is a BBC series presented by Dr. Rupy Aujla. In each episode, Dr. Aujla invites a guest to his kitchen and together they cook a delicious and nutritious meal. The guests range from celebrities to patients, and each one shares their personal story of how food has impacted their health and wellbeing.
The recipes featured in Cooking In The Doctor's Kitchen are always based on whole foods, and are designed to be easy and quick to make. Dr. Aujla shows viewers how to use simple ingredients to create delicious meals that are good for your body and your taste buds.
